Run into the river to support those in greatest need in Buffalo & Erie County!
The I.M. Freeze is a charity dash into the cold Niagara river that brings people together to share their passion for building up our community and helping those in greatest need.
- Saturday, March 30th at 10 am - NEW DATE
- Beaver Island State Park on Grand Island
- After-party at Say Cheese restaurant
